Addiction recovery priorities: Learn healthy ways to cope with stress

Learning healthy ways of coping with stress is very important in the long journey of addiction recovery priorities. Experts at AWAREmed health and wellness resource center led by doctor Dalal Akoury MD reiterates that even after you’ve recovered from drug addiction, you’ll still have to face the problems that led to your drug problems in the first place. Did you start using drugs to numb painful emotions, calm yourself down after an argument, unwind after a bad day, or forget about your problems? After you become sober, the negative feelings that you used to dampen with drugs will resurface. For treatment to be successful, and to remain sober in the long term, you’ll need to resolve these underlying issues as well.

Conditions such as stress, loneliness, frustration, anger, shame, anxiety, and hopelessness will remain in your life even when you’re no longer using drugs to cover them up. But you will be in a healthier position to finally address them and seek the help you need.

 Relieving stress without drugs

Drug abuse often curtails from misguided attempts to manage stress. Many people turn to alcohol or recreational drugs to unwind and relax after a stressful day, or to cover up painful memories and emotions that cause us to feel stressed and out of balance. But there are healthier ways to keep your stress level in check, including exercising, meditating, using sensory strategies to relax, practicing simple breathing exercises, and challenging self-defeating thoughts.

Addiction recovery priorities: Strategies for quickly relieving stress without drugs

You may feel like doing drugs is the only way to handle unpleasant feelings, but it’s not. You can learn to get through difficulties without falling back on your addiction. Different quick stress relief strategies work better for some people than others. The key is to find the one that works best for you, and helps you calm down when you’re feeling stressed and overwhelmed. When you’re confident in your ability to quickly de-stress, facing strong feelings isn’t as intimidating or overwhelming.

  • Exercise releases endorphins, relieves stress, and promotes emotional well-being. Try running in place, jumping rope, or walking around the block.
  • Step outside and savor the warm sun and fresh air. Enjoy a beautiful view or landscape.
  • Yoga and meditation are excellent ways to bust stress and find balance.
  • Play with your dog or cat, enjoying the relaxing touch of your pet’s fur.
  • Put on some calming music.
  • Light a scented candle.
  • Breathe in the scent of fresh flowers or coffee beans, or savor a scent that reminds you of a favorite vacation, such as sunscreen or a seashell.
  • Close your eyes and picture a peaceful place, such as a sandy beach. Or think of a fond memory, such as your child’s first steps or time spent with friends.
  • Make yourself a steaming cup of tea.
  • Look at favorite family photos.
  • Give yourself a neck or shoulder massage.
  • Soak in a hot bath or shower.

Drug addiction realities and penalties: Legal consequences

Humanity has from creation lived in strict observation of rules and regulations. This system has been passed from generation to generation and today all nations globally operate within certain perimeters of laws. These laws include laws governing drug abuse detailing the consequences of any infringements which may include a lifetime in the confinement in prison, hefty fine or both. When one if found on the wrong side of the law other things likely to follow will include:

Criminal Record:  the affected person will have a criminal record on their file and this will tarnish individual’s reputation with the authorities and the society.

Career and employment: the affected person will lose many employment opportunities since most employers require certification of good conduct.

Licenses: with a criminal record on your head you are likely to miss certain opportunities in a business like getting a license to operate a liquor business or drive a taxi.

Travel: with the advent of global terrorism having a criminal record will restrict your travel and movement as many countries will not give you a visa.

Social Status: people do not want to associate with criminals less they be branded criminals too (birds of the same feathers flock together) this will injure your relationship with your co-workers, neighbors and even relationships with your family and friends. In other words, criminal records assassinate one’s character completely.

Drug addiction realities and penalties: Consequences related to health

One of the greatest assets in human life if that of peace of mind and it is easily affected by drugs and addiction. The effects are either physical or psychological.

Physical Health – Drug abuse can adversely affect every major system in the human body. Like for instance, alcohol and cigarette smoking may cause fatal illness like cancer.

Psychological Health – Mental health problems such as depression, developmental lags, apathy, withdrawal, and other psychosocial dysfunctions are linked to substance abuse among adolescents. Others include conduct problems, personality disorders, suicidal thoughts, attempted suicide, and suicide.

Addiction – often people think they can never get addicted, this is misleading since addiction can knock on your doors at any time. Such people often suffers the loss of control and sound judgment, and when they stop using the substance, they are likely to suffer severe psychological or physical symptoms, such as anxiety, irritability, unhappiness and stress. It must be noted that teenagers who have made a routine in using drugs are really not experimenting but are recreational drug users. Their action may appear in the understanding of the society to be using drugs moderately meaning that such substance use does not cause any significant problem to them or others. Nonetheless, proper caution must take because the content of the substance/drugs doesn’t change and must remain within the regulated dose. Speaking to the experts at AWAREmed health and wellness resource center under the leadership of doctor Dalal Akoury MD, when we talk of using drugs in moderation, it simply means:

  • That use is intentional, not automatic.
  • It is a matter of choice it is not dictated by habit.
  • That the choice is independently made and not dependent on socially fitting in, going along, keeping up, or competing for most use.

Second the use is monitored. Monitored use means being gradual and so your teenager maintains sufficient awareness of the effects of use on mind and body to judge when they need to have no more. Substance use takes the alcohol user, for example, from a caring (sober) to a less caring (high) to a completely care-free (drunken) state. Recreational drinkers draw a line somewhere been a caring and non-caring condition that demarcates when enough has been consumed.

They want to use within the limits of maintaining contact with the values and judgments about personal behavior that normally matter to them. They don’t want to cross over the enough line into a significantly less caring or non-caring state where words can be spoken, decisions made, and actions taken that later sober reflection will cause them (or others) to regret. Recreational using means maintaining sufficient presence of mind to stop when one has had enough.

Recreational drug users: Excessive use of drugs

This happens in many different ways, it sometimes happens accidentally or intentionally, a teenager will get extremely drunk and wasted. It’s important for parents to determine if the excess was accidental or intentional. Accidental excess comes as a surprise, and the effects can have a cautionary value. Thus a teenager, who never drank hard liquor before, drinks so much so fast he bypasses feeling drunk, passes out, and is rushed to the hospital which pumps his stomach out as part of their intervention to prevent alcoholic poisoning. Coming to, the teenager reflects on the fact that he almost killed himself by accidental excess and, when making the best of a bad situation, feels disinclined to drink that much that fast again.

Finally, doctor Akoury reiterates that, anytime you have a teenager who likes to drink to get drunk, you have a problem drinker on your hands. If he or she is running with a drink to get drunk crowd, do what you can to discourage that socializing union. Using or drinking to deliberate excess is a common bridge to the next level, substance abuse and must be discouraged.
